Program: Assertive Community Treatment (ACT)

Responsibilities: Provide direct care to members and clinical supervision to ACT staff. Dedicate approximately 50% of work time to the direct provision of clinical services to ACT members. Ensure services provided correspond to NYS OMH program model guidelines and ensure compliance with MHA QA/UR policies and procedures. Serve as a liaison at Rockland County SPOA and represent MHA at other community and professional meetings as requested. Provide managerial and fiscal oversight of all services and billing. Participate in all staff recruitment and make recommendations regarding the hiring of new staff. Ensure that all ACT staff receive core competency trainings as per NY State OMH regulations and best practices. Assist in the preparation of reports and budgets required by regulatory agencies and MHA. Work collaboratively with County employees (OMH, County Attorney’s Office, AOT Coordinator) to ensure care coordination of ACT clients.

Requirements: A master’s degree or higher in social work, psychology, rehabilitation counseling or a related field, OR licensure/registration as a registered nurse, nurse practitioner or doctor. Four (4) years post-grad experience working with adults with severe mental illness, with some supervisory experience required. Experience working with a diverse population preferred. Experience working on a multi-disciplinary mobile team preferred. Must be available for 24/7 for telephone support of staff for occasional emergencies. Strong written, verbal, and organizational skills needed. Valid driver’s license required.
